I pick up QQ in the SB with 27 players left and the Tournament Big Stack who has just arrived at the table and playing his first hand raises a modest 3xBB. Its folded to me in the SB and my first thought was "Well I'll show him he's not gonna push this table around" and I shove all in. You can see the results below.

My question to anyone who would like to respond: What is your thought process here and what do you think the best way to proceed with this hand is after his 3xBB raise while sitting in the SB and it's folded to you?

27 Players left/ Your 2nd in chips at your table / Your M is at 11 ( but you still hold a very respectable amount of chips compared to the Avg. Chip Stack )

Well, you can call and go broke on the flop instead. Seriously, you're not folding, you're only thought should be getting value, pushing seems like the way ahead so long as he's calling with JJ+, AK and raising a wider range. He's not going to fold KK-AA so there doesn't seem any point in raising short of a push as you'll be committed anyway.
